Q1 2025 earnings summary
8 Jul, 2026Executive summary
Achieved record Q1 2025 revenue of $222.3 million, up 15.4% year-over-year, driven by double-digit organic growth in both residential and multifamily/commercial segments and strong U.S. market performance.
Single-family residential revenues grew 21.6% year-over-year to $88.9 million, while multifamily/commercial revenues increased 11.6% to $133.4 million, supported by geographic expansion and robust project backlog.
Gross margin improved to 43.9%, up 510 basis points year-over-year, reflecting stronger pricing, favorable mix, operating leverage, and FX benefits.
Net income rose 42% year-over-year to $42.2 million ($0.90 per diluted share); adjusted net income was $43.1 million ($0.92 per share).
Backlog expanded 24.9% year-over-year to a record $1.14 billion, providing strong visibility into 2025 and 2026.
Financial highlights
Total revenues for Q1 2025 reached $222.3 million, up 15.4% year-over-year, with U.S. accounting for 95% of revenues.
Adjusted EBITDA was $70.2 million (31.6% margin), up from $51 million (26.5% margin) in the prior year.
Gross profit was $97.5 million (43.9% margin), up from $74.7 million (38.8% margin) last year.
SG&A expenses rose to $42.5 million (19.1% of revenues), mainly due to higher transportation, commissions, personnel, and $4.7 million in tariff expenses.
Operating cash flow was $46.9 million; free cash flow reached a record $28.8 million.
Outlook and guidance
Raised 2025 revenue outlook to $960 million–$1.02 billion, implying 11% growth at midpoint; adjusted EBITDA guidance updated to $305 million–$330 million.
High-end guidance assumes favorable interest rates, strong residential and vinyl growth, and gross margins in the mid to high 40% range; low-end guidance reflects conservative volume growth, potential tariff headwinds, and gross margins in the low 40% range.
Outlook includes ~$25 million full-year impact from higher input costs and tariffs, expected to be offset by pricing and supply chain actions.
Capital expenditures projected at $45–$55 million for 2025.
Management expects continued positive operating cash flow and sufficient liquidity to meet obligations over the next twelve months.
